Rajnath exhorts people to vote for BJP candidates

Hyderabad: Union Home Minister Rajnath Singh today said people were not believing on the alliance of TDP and Congress.

Addressing an election meeting at JNS stadium in Hanamakonda Rajnath Singh said Warangal town has history. It was first BJP MP elected from Warangal Loksabha in 1984, he reminded. Since the Warangal has given first BJP MP to the nation, the centre has granted Smart city, Amrut city, Heritage city projecgs for its development, the union home minister said.

Criticising functioning of TRS government, Rajnath Singh alleged that KCR has failed to keep his world who had promised to provide double bed room to poor and houses to Journalists. BJP will do what it will talk and people are supporting BJP for its developmental works, he said adding that during the regime of Vajpayee gove4nment four lines, six lines and rural roads were developed and Modi government also working with the same spirit. The country is on the path of progress under the leadership of prime minister Narendra Modi and it was ranked sixth in top ten country in the world.

Rajnath Singh said three states created by Vajpayee government are progressing rapidly, but Telangana and AP are lagging behind development. KCR claimed that he has developed the state, then why 4500 people have committed suicide. He called up people to chase those who asked vote on religion basis. TDP and Congress have come together against the BJP. But people are not believing on this unholy alliance, he said.

Taking a dig at Rahul Gandhi, Rajnath Singh said Rahul Gandhi has said that he will set up a potato factory and from his announcement we can imagine the vision of Congress party. BJP always works for protection of the country and people. If one bullet comes from Pakistan side, that country may not be able to count how many bullets were fired from our side”, he roared.

Appealing people to vote for BJP candidates, Rajnath Singh said he will come back to Warangal city for thanks-giving after winning of BJP candidate Dharma Rao.
